Feels weird to miss someone you don't know, but I'll do it for Gandolfini.

He had the writing to back him, but it was truly a revolutionary performance; one of the greatest ever filmed. And because he was so good and could anchor that show, television drama was fundamentally changed. TV could play a long game, and unspool like a novel. With that much depth.

He gave some excellent movie performances (I particularly liked him in Get Shorty and True Romance), but 95% of what he'll be known for is Tony Soprano.
